Cheap but accurate (bathroom) scales

Has anybody seen any good deals for scales about? Or has some they would recommend?:confused:

I think I would prefer digital (as trying to lose weight so think this will be easier) but last time I dieted I got digital ones from Lloyds Pharmacy and the display went funny after about 6 months.

So any recommendations welcomed!

Thanks everybody!

    but last time I dieted I got digital ones from Lloyds Pharmacy and the display went funny after about 6 months.

    Didn't you take them back - they would have been guaranteed.

    We bought some nice ones from Lidl or Aldi recently, just glass with a digital display, nothing fancy like working out BMI or anything, just displays weight in pounds or kgs. They cost around £8-£9 and are guaranteed for 3 years.

    Wherever you get them front, keep the receipt and guarantee information and take them back to the retailer if they go wrong.
